Known as the "prince of promotions," P. T. Barnum was famous for his incredible creativity and imagination. But it is how he applied these talents that lured thousands to his circus year after year. With sideshows and a midway as teasers, he enticed his audience—turning their attention to his main draws—Tom Thumb, the bearded ladies, two-headed animals, the tattooed lady and the giant. However, had he relied on the midway and sideshows alone to fill seats, P. T. would not have succeeded. Realizing that excellent marketing and promotion were key to the longevity of his business, he delivered his message to the masses by holding parades that featured his attractions in town squares, putting up posters, passing out flyers, getting his story in the media, and doing whatever else it took to seize the spotlight. For the C.E.O., entrepreneur, professional or book author, this book holds many of the most effective, efficient and affordable marketing tools my clients and I repeatedly employ to catch customers, garnish publicity and sell more of our products and services. I hope you will use them to intensify your visibility, amplify your impact and augment your promotional activities. Just by investing time and money on the best marketing tool you have . . . YOU too can build your tribe and twinkle like the star you're meant to be!!
